#d74a18 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#d74a18 is composed of 84.3% red, 29% green and 9.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 65.6% magenta, 88.8% yellow and 15.7% black. It has a hue angle of 15.7 degrees, a saturation of 79.9% and a lightness of 46.9%. #d74a18 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ff9430 with #af0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3300.

Shades and Tints of #d74a18

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030100 is the darkest color, while #fdf4f1 is the lightest one.

Tones of #d74a18

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7b7674 is the less saturated color, while #e94106 is the most saturated one.
